What Does an a Auto Insurance Agent in Morton Cost?
The average cost of auto insurance in Illinois is around 1,300 dollars per year for minimum coverage and 2,200 dollars per year for full coverage. In Morton, rates may vary based on your driving record, vehicle type, and credit history.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the minimum auto insurance requirements in Illinois?
Illinois requires liability coverage of 25,000 dollars per person for bodily injury, 50,000 dollars per accident for bodily injury, and 20,000 dollars for property damage. You must also carry uninsured motorist coverage of 25,000 dollars per person and 50,000 dollars per accident.
How can an auto insurance agent in Morton help me save money?
An agent can compare multiple insurance companies to find competitive rates. They can also identify discounts you may qualify for, such as multi-policy discounts, safe driver discounts, or good student discounts.
Do I need full coverage auto insurance in Morton?
Full coverage is not required by Illinois law, but it is often required if you finance or lease your vehicle. Full coverage includes collision and comprehensive insurance, which protect your car from damage and theft.
